SCIENCE OF LEARNING APPROACH

You can imagine TTRS couldn't have the impact it does if it didn't take an evidence-backed approach to learning. Sure enough, our programme is strongly rooted in the science of learning - spaced reptition, interleaved material, low-stakes retrieval and intelligent practice - so that students have happy long-term memories of learning the tables.

ALTERNATIVE PROVISION

With many accessibility features, TTRS is suitable in non-mainstream settings for learners with additional needs. For example, colour schemes and font sizes can be changed to cater for visual impairments, questions can be read out and answered by voice, and our games are screen-reader compatible. Students can also declutter the screen, play “anonymous” and hide the timer, to help reduce maths anxiety. TTRS is a useful intervention tool that can be used to identify gaps in learning, and help teachers provide targeted support on a one-to-one or small group basis.

TT Rock Stars is suitable for all learners aged 6 years and upwards who need to learn, or get quicker at recalling their times tables and division facts. It is used in many primary and secondary schools worldwide.

The Stats Bolt-on is an optional extra that allows teachers to view and download extra data on pupils’ progress in speed and accuracy, view graphs of activity, print leaderboards that are ready for display and create auto-filled certificates. Click here to find our more.
The Sessions bolt-on is an optional extra that allows you to be more purposeful about the use of TTRS by your pupils. It enables you to set specific tasks, often used for homework, and then allows you to easily see which pupils are completing those tasks and who needs extra encouragement.
